@keyframes ScrollMarquee_underline-link-underline-draw__hYAGc{0%{transform-origin:right center}30%{transform:scaleX(0);transform-origin:right center}50%{transform:scaleX(0);transform-origin:left center}to{transform:scaleX(1);transform-origin:left center}}.ScrollMarquee_inner__a_Ylm{display:flex;align-items:center}.ScrollMarquee_base__W6pOZ{margin-left:calc(var(--side-padding)*-1);margin-right:calc(var(--side-padding)*-1);padding-left:calc(var(--side-padding));padding-right:calc(var(--side-padding));overflow:hidden;position:relative;opacity:1;transition:opacity 333ms}.ScrollMarquee_base__W6pOZ.ScrollMarquee_hover__JWbLm{opacity:0}.ScrollMarquee_base__W6pOZ .ScrollMarquee_extra__mOvWl,.ScrollMarquee_base__W6pOZ .ScrollMarquee_main__fGAZK,.ScrollMarquee_base__W6pOZ .ScrollMarquee_paddding__1yvgD,.ScrollMarquee_base__W6pOZ .ScrollMarquee_post__3rdoJ,.ScrollMarquee_base__W6pOZ .ScrollMarquee_pre__QBJbE{font-family:Tobias,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;letter-spacing:-.03em;font-weight:300;display:flex;align-items:center;font-size:calc(4rem + min(4vw, 76.8px));line-height:1.5;transform:translate(-100%);white-space:nowrap;max-width:none;flex:0 0 auto;letter-spacing:normal}.ScrollMarquee_base__W6pOZ .ScrollMarquee_item__6InJh{display:flex;align-items:center;background:var(--color-background);color:var(--color-foreground);position:relative}.ScrollMarquee_base__W6pOZ .ScrollMarquee_item__6InJh:before{content:"";display:block;width:.25em;height:.25em;border-radius:50%;background:var(--color-accent);margin:.15em .2em 0;flex:0 0 auto}.ScrollMarquee_base__W6pOZ .ScrollMarquee_item__6InJh:after{content:var(--theme-icon);position:absolute;display:inline-block;font-size:.5em;left:.145em;top:.928em}@keyframes CaseStudyThumb_underline-link-underline-draw__Dnxlj{0%{transform-origin:right center}30%{transform:scaleX(0);transform-origin:right center}50%{transform:scaleX(0);transform-origin:left center}to{transform:scaleX(1);transform-origin:left center}}.CaseStudyThumb_image__GTOSg,.CaseStudyThumb_video__djmAq{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;transition:transform 666ms cubic-bezier(.666,0,.237,1) .15s;position:relative;transform:scale(1.25);will-change:transform}.CaseStudyThumb_ready__GAjtz .CaseStudyThumb_image__GTOSg,.CaseStudyThumb_ready__GAjtz .CaseStudyThumb_video__djmAq{transform:scale(1)}.CaseStudyThumb_isPrivate__OndCU .CaseStudyThumb_image__GTOSg,.CaseStudyThumb_isPrivate__OndCU .CaseStudyThumb_video__djmAq{filter:blur(30px)}@keyframes CTA_underline-link-underline-draw__Cx5uR{0%{transform-origin:right center}30%{transform:scaleX(0);transform-origin:right center}50%{transform:scaleX(0);transform-origin:left center}to{transform:scaleX(1);transform-origin:left center}}.CTA_link__SYAaT{font-family:Roobert,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;letter-spacing:-.03em;line-height:1.5;color:inherit;text-decoration:none;font-size:1.1em;font-weight:600}.CTA_arrow___mJlw{display:inline-block;width:.6em;height:.6em;border:2px solid var(--color-accent);border-left:none;border-bottom:none;position:relative;margin-left:.5em;transform:translate(-10%,10%);transition:transform 333ms cubic-bezier(.666,0,.237,1)}.CTA_link__SYAaT:hover .CTA_arrow___mJlw{transform:translate(10%,-10%)}.CTA_arrow___mJlw:after{content:"";position:absolute;background:var(--color-accent);width:2px;height:.8em;right:-2px;top:0;transform-origin:100% 0;transform:rotate(45deg) translate(-.2px,.2px)}@keyframes CaseStudyCard_underline-link-underline-draw__wdCf_{0%{transform-origin:right center}30%{transform:scaleX(0);transform-origin:right center}50%{transform:scaleX(0);transform-origin:left center}to{transform:scaleX(1);transform-origin:left center}}.CaseStudyCard_card__ea_6m{padding:calc(.25rem + min(1vw, 19.2px) + 4vh) 0;width:100%;margin-left:auto;margin-right:auto;max-width:1440px;position:relative}@media screen and (min-width:900px){.CaseStudyCard_card__ea_6m{padding:calc(4rem + min(1vw, 19.2px) + 4vh) 0}}.CaseStudyCard_thumb__KCrgw{width:100%;position:relative;display:block;padding-bottom:65%;overflow:hidden;height:0;color:inherit;text-decoration:none}@media screen and (min-width:900px){.CaseStudyCard_thumb__KCrgw{width:80%;padding-bottom:44%}.CaseStudyCard_left__ifiWu .CaseStudyCard_thumb__KCrgw{left:20%}.CaseStudyCard_right__WJZsL .CaseStudyCard_thumb__KCrgw{left:0}}.CaseStudyCard_thumbContent__QsKJc{position:absolute;top:0;left:0;height:100%;width:100%;overflow:hidden;background:#151515;cursor:pointer}.CaseStudyCard_thumbContent__QsKJc:after,.CaseStudyCard_thumbContent__QsKJc:before{content:"";width:100%;height:100%;position:absolute;display:block;left:0;top:0;transition:transform 599.4ms cubic-bezier(.666,0,.237,1);will-change:transform}.CaseStudyCard_ready__5u5Fm .CaseStudyCard_thumbContent__QsKJc:after,.CaseStudyCard_ready__5u5Fm .CaseStudyCard_thumbContent__QsKJc:before{transform:translateX(100%)}.CaseStudyCard_right__WJZsL.CaseStudyCard_ready__5u5Fm .CaseStudyCard_thumbContent__QsKJc:after,.CaseStudyCard_right__WJZsL.CaseStudyCard_ready__5u5Fm .CaseStudyCard_thumbContent__QsKJc:before{transform:translateX(-100%)}.CaseStudyCard_thumbContent__QsKJc:before{background:var(--color-accent);transition-delay:133.2ms;z-index:1}.CaseStudyCard_thumbContent__QsKJc:after{background:var(--color-background);z-index:2}.CaseStudyCard_comingSoon__7lNbC{font-family:Roobert,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;letter-spacing:-.03em;line-height:1.5;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%) rotate(29deg);background:var(--color-accent);display:flex}.CaseStudyCard_right__WJZsL .CaseStudyCard_comingSoon__7lNbC{transform:translate(-50%,-50%) rotate(-29deg)}.CaseStudyCard_comingSoon__7lNbC span{white-space:nowrap;font-size:clamp(.75rem,1vw,3rem);padding:.5em 0}.CaseStudyCard_comingSoon__7lNbC span:before{content:"-";padding:0 .5em}.CaseStudyCard_comingSoon__7lNbC span:after{content:"Coming Soon";padding:0 .5em}.CaseStudyCard_copy__AluLc{position:relative;display:flex;flex-direction:column;margin-top:1rem}.CaseStudyCard_left__ifiWu .CaseStudyCard_copy__AluLc{left:-1px}.CaseStudyCard_right__WJZsL .CaseStudyCard_copy__AluLc{right:-1px;align-items:flex-end}@media(min-width:900px){.CaseStudyCard_copy__AluLc{margin-top:auto;bottom:16%;position:absolute}}.CaseStudyCard_clientWrapper__4g34r,.CaseStudyCard_linkWrapper__J5_XM,.CaseStudyCard_titleWrapper__qKWcU{overflow:hidden;position:relative;background:var(--color-background);display:inline-block;vertical-align:top;color:inherit;text-decoration:none}.CaseStudyCard_clientWrapper__4g34r{margin-bottom:-1px}@media screen and (min-width:900px){.CaseStudyCard_linkWrapper__J5_XM{margin-top:.5em}}.CaseStudyCard_client__6baka,.CaseStudyCard_link__cr2d_,.CaseStudyCard_title__ZsLp6{display:inline-block;position:relative;transition:transform 666ms cubic-bezier(.666,0,.237,1);transform:translateY(10rem);will-change:transform}.CaseStudyCard_copyReady__DDmfy .CaseStudyCard_client__6baka,.CaseStudyCard_copyReady__DDmfy .CaseStudyCard_link__cr2d_,.CaseStudyCard_copyReady__DDmfy .CaseStudyCard_title__ZsLp6{transform:translateY(0)}.CaseStudyCard_left__ifiWu .CaseStudyCard_client__6baka,.CaseStudyCard_left__ifiWu .CaseStudyCard_link__cr2d_,.CaseStudyCard_left__ifiWu .CaseStudyCard_title__ZsLp6{padding-right:.15em}.CaseStudyCard_right__WJZsL .CaseStudyCard_client__6baka,.CaseStudyCard_right__WJZsL .CaseStudyCard_link__cr2d_,.CaseStudyCard_right__WJZsL .CaseStudyCard_title__ZsLp6{padding-left:.15em;padding-right:.15em}.CaseStudyCard_client__6baka{font-family:Roobert,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;letter-spacing:-.03em;line-height:1.5;font-weight:600;font-size:1rem}@media screen and (min-width:900px){.CaseStudyCard_client__6baka{font-size:clamp(1.5rem,2vw,6rem)}}.CaseStudyCard_title__ZsLp6{font-family:Tobias,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;font-weight:300;letter-spacing:-.03em;transition-delay:.1s;font-size:2rem;line-height:1.25}@media screen and (min-width:900px){.CaseStudyCard_title__ZsLp6{font-size:clamp(2rem,5vw,12rem)}}.CaseStudyCard_link__cr2d_{transition-delay:.2s;font-size:.8em}@media(min-width:900px){.CaseStudyCard_link__cr2d_{font-size:1.1em}}@keyframes index_underline-link-underline-draw__OkYn0{0%{transform-origin:right center}30%{transform:scaleX(0);transform-origin:right center}50%{transform:scaleX(0);transform-origin:left center}to{transform:scaleX(1);transform-origin:left center}}.index_videos__qmReb{position:fixed;top:0;left:0;width:100vw;height:100vh;overflow:hidden;pointer-events:none;display:none;border-radius:0}.index_videos__qmReb.index_ready__X0ePx{display:block}.index_videos__qmReb video{position:absolute;opacity:0;width:100%;height:100%;transition:opacity 333ms;-o-object-fit:cover;object-fit:cover;-o-object-position:initial;object-position:initial}.index_videos__qmReb video.index_logoVideo__BUjk9{-o-object-fit:contain;object-fit:contain}@media(min-width:500px){.index_videos__qmReb video.index_logoVideo__BUjk9{-o-object-fit:cover;object-fit:cover}}.index_videos__qmReb video.index_active__L1e8f{background:#fff;opacity:1}.index_noOrphansPlease__tMl_I{display:none}@media(min-width:500px){.index_noOrphansPlease__tMl_I{display:inline-block}}@media(min-width:1200px){.index_noOrphansPlease__tMl_I{display:none}}.index_base__9DDei{position:relative}.index_base__9DDei .index_heroSection__Pu0tB{display:flex;flex-direction:column;justify-content:center;padding:calc(5rem + min(1vw, 19.2px) + 4vh) 0;width:100%;margin-left:auto;margin-right:auto;max-width:1440px;opacity:0}@media(min-width:0px){.index_base__9DDei .index_heroSection__Pu0tB{min-height:100vh}}.index_base__9DDei .index_heroSection__Pu0tB span{opacity:0;transition:opacity 666ms}.index_base__9DDei .index_heroSection__Pu0tB em{opacity:0;transition:opacity 333ms}.index_base__9DDei .index_heroSection__Pu0tB h1 em:first-of-type{transition-delay:333ms}.index_base__9DDei .index_heroSection__Pu0tB h1 em:nth-of-type(2){transition-delay:666ms}.index_base__9DDei .index_heroSection__Pu0tB p em:first-of-type{transition-delay:999ms}.index_base__9DDei .index_heroSection__Pu0tB p em:nth-of-type(2){transition-delay:1332ms}.index_base__9DDei .index_heroSection__Pu0tB span{transition-delay:1998ms}.index_base__9DDei .index_heroSection__Pu0tB.index_ready__X0ePx,.index_base__9DDei .index_heroSection__Pu0tB.index_ready__X0ePx em,.index_base__9DDei .index_heroSection__Pu0tB.index_ready__X0ePx span{opacity:1}.index_base__9DDei .index_heroSection__Pu0tB.index_introduced___qiXW h1 em,.index_base__9DDei .index_heroSection__Pu0tB.index_introduced___qiXW h1 span,.index_base__9DDei .index_heroSection__Pu0tB.index_introduced___qiXW p em,.index_base__9DDei .index_heroSection__Pu0tB.index_introduced___qiXW p span{transition-delay:0ms;transition:all 333ms}.index_base__9DDei h1,.index_base__9DDei h1~.index_also-title__ecuQb{font-family:Tobias,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;letter-spacing:-.03em;font-weight:300;font-size:clamp(2rem,8vw,4rem);line-height:1.1em;font-size:1.75rem}.index_base__9DDei h1>em,.index_base__9DDei h1~.index_also-title__ecuQb>em{font-family:Roobert,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;letter-spacing:-.03em;line-height:1.5;line-height:1.1em;font-style:normal;font-weight:500}@media(min-width:360px){.index_base__9DDei h1,.index_base__9DDei h1~.index_also-title__ecuQb{font-size:9vw}}@media(min-width:500px){.index_base__9DDei h1,.index_base__9DDei h1~.index_also-title__ecuQb{font-size:7.95vw}}@media(min-width:900px){.index_base__9DDei h1,.index_base__9DDei h1~.index_also-title__ecuQb{font-size:5.8vw}}@media(min-width:1200px){.index_base__9DDei h1,.index_base__9DDei h1~.index_also-title__ecuQb{font-size:5vw}}@media(min-width:1440px){.index_base__9DDei h1,.index_base__9DDei h1~.index_also-title__ecuQb{font-size:5.4vw}}@media(min-width:1920px){.index_base__9DDei h1,.index_base__9DDei h1~.index_also-title__ecuQb{font-size:6rem}}.index_base__9DDei h1:first-child,.index_base__9DDei h1~.index_also-title__ecuQb:first-child{margin-top:2em}@media screen and (min-width:500px){.index_base__9DDei h1:first-child,.index_base__9DDei h1~.index_also-title__ecuQb:first-child{margin-top:0}}.index_base__9DDei h1:not(:first-child),.index_base__9DDei h1~.index_also-title__ecuQb:not(:first-child){margin-top:1em}.index_base__9DDei em{position:relative;cursor:pointer}.index_base__9DDei em:hover{background-color:var(--color-accent)}.index_base__9DDei em,.index_base__9DDei span{opacity:1;transition:all 333ms}.index_base__9DDei.index_hover__HLJs7 em,.index_base__9DDei.index_hover__HLJs7 span{opacity:0!important}.index_base__9DDei.index_hover__HLJs7 em.index_active__L1e8f{opacity:1!important}.index_base__9DDei .index_caseStudies__MMtoP{display:flex;flex-direction:column;justify-content:center;padding:0;transition:opacity .1665s ease-out .1665s}@media(min-width:0px){.index_base__9DDei .index_caseStudies__MMtoP{min-height:100vh}}.index_base__9DDei .index_caseStudies__MMtoP.index_hover__HLJs7{opacity:0;transition:opacity .1665s ease-out}.index_base__9DDei .index_marqueeSection__J0T_y{display:flex;flex-direction:column;justify-content:center;padding:calc(5rem + min(1vw, 19.2px) + 4vh) 0}@media(min-width:900px){.index_base__9DDei .index_marqueeSection__J0T_y{min-height:100vh}}